FTC warns of revived 'unclaimed life insurance' scam, which has targeted Coloradans | Denver7 Investigates

The Federal Trade Commission (FTC) has issued a warning about a revived 'unclaimed life insurance' scam targeting Coloradans, where scammers pose as lawyers claiming individuals are heirs to non-existent life insurance policies. Victims are pressured to provide personal financial information or pay upfront fees, with Colorado families, including Eric Lozano’s in Morrison, reported as targets.
